UM chooses Shannon as head football coach

BY SUSAN MILLER DEGNAN, BARRY JACKSON AND MICHELLE KAUFMAN

sdegnan@MiamiHerald.com

The University of Miami has a new head football coach.

UM defensive coordinator Randy Shannon accepted the position Thursday, according to a well-placed university source.

An announcement by UM is scheduled for Friday.

Shannon, 40, a Miami native, becomes only the sixth black head coach in Division I football. He replaces Larry Coker, who was fired last month after six seasons.

Shannon graduated from Norland High and then UM in 1989. He was a member of the 1987 Hurricanes national championship team and an 11th-round draft choice of the Dallas Cowboys in 1989. Shannon was a Miami Dolphins defensive assistant in 1998 and 1999 before becoming Miami's linebackers coach in 2000.

He returned to UM in 2001 as defensive coordinator, and became the first UM coach to win the Frank Broyles Award that year as the top assistant in college football. Shannon's defenses have been outstanding every season, including this one, in which UM (6-6) is ranked fifth in total defense, fourth in rushing defense and 12th in scoring defense. Shannon's son, Xavier Shannon, is an offensive lineman for Florida International University.
